Usual Issues Experienced by Ipad Users
Whilst iPad users enjoy a variety of features and functionalities, they commonly encounter common issues that can disrupt their experience. One prevalent problem is battery drain, where users notice their device losing power rapidly, often resulting from background applications or software glitches. Another issue is a slow performance, which can stem from inadequate storage or outdated software, making tasks frustratingly sluggish. Moreover, screen issues, such as unresponsiveness or cracks, often occur due to accidental drops or impacts. Connectivity problems, particularly with Wi-Fi and Bluetooth, can disrupt users trying to access the internet or connect to other devices. Overheating is also a problem, usually tied to intensive applications or environmental factors. Additionally, software bugs and app crashes can result in unexpected interruptions in usage. These common issues can significantly impact the overall functionality and satisfaction of iPad users, demanding timely attention and potential repair solutions.

Cost Considerations for Ipad Repair
Picking a repair service is only the initial step; understanding the costs associated with iPad repairs is equally important. Several factors impact these costs, including the type of damage, model of the iPad, and the repair service chosen. Common repairs, such as screen replacements, can vary considerably in price, often ranging from $100 to $300 depending on the device model and repair shop.
Additionally, original parts usually cost more than third-party alternatives, influencing overall repair fees. Warranty coverage also comes into play, as work under warranty may involve less expensive fees or be completely covered.
It's crucial to get a thorough estimate before proceeding with repairs. This transparency allows consumers prevent unexpected fees. Eventually, understanding these cost considerations allows iPad owners to make well-informed decisions about repair options while weighing quality and affordability.
Recommendations for Keeping Your Ipad in Good Condition After Repair
Though repairs can recover an iPad to top functionality, preserving its performance calls for continuous care and attention. Regular software updates are vital, as they enhance security and optimize performance. Users should also control storage properly by deleting unused apps and files, preventing slowdowns.
Furthermore, safeguarding the device from physical damage is vital; utilizing a premium case and screen protector can reduce risks from drops and scratches. It is wise to stay away from extreme temperatures and moisture, which can impact the internal components.
Keeping the iPad battery level between 20% and 80% supports battery longevity. Users should also periodically restart the device to remove temporary files and boost operational efficiency.
Last but not least, regularly backing up data regularly makes certain that crucial information is protected in the event of issues. By following these guidelines, users can prolong the lifespan of their iPad and maintain its functionality following repair.

What Tools Are Needed for DIY Ipad Repair?
For DIY iPad repair, essential tools include a precision screwdriver set, plastic opening tools, tweezers, a suction cup, and a heat gun. These implements support safe disassembly and reassembly, reducing damage during the repair process.
